Expert Flex Duct Installation Tips for Efficient Home Ventilation

Flex duct installation is a critical component of modern HVAC systems, directly influencing both the efficiency of climate control and the overall air quality within a residential or commercial space. This flexible conduit, often made from wire-coated polyester or plasticized aluminum, serves as the vital connection between the main trunk line and the individual registers throughout a property. When installed correctly, it provides the necessary resilience to navigate tight spaces without kinking, ensuring consistent airflow.

However, the success of the entire ventilation network hinges on the precision of this specific installation phase. Unlike rigid metal ducts, flex duct requires a specific methodology to balance flexibility with performance. Understanding the nuances of proper handling, ideal length limitations, and connection techniques is essential for HVAC professionals and diligent homeowners alike who aim to optimize their environmental systems.

Understanding Flex Duct and Its Role

Before diving into the installation specifics, it is important to understand what flex duct actually is and why it is so widely used. Essentially, it is a pre-insulated, flexible tube that transports conditioned air from the central unit to various outlets. Its primary advantage lies in its ability to bend around obstacles, which significantly reduces installation time and labor costs compared to traditional sheet metal ductwork.

Despite its convenience, flex duct has inherent limitations that dictate how it must be handled. It possesses a higher internal friction loss than rigid ducts, meaning airflow resistance is greater. Consequently, installation codes and best practices strictly regulate its length and diameter to ensure the HVAC system can still move the required volume of air effectively without straining the blower motor.

Pre-Installation Planning and Measurement

A successful flex duct installation begins long before the first clamp is tightened. Thorough planning involves mapping out the path the duct will take, ensuring it avoids sharp bends and crushing points. The goal is to maintain a smooth, rounded trajectory to facilitate unobstructed airflow.

Key considerations during this phase include:

  • Determining the required length to minimize sagging or excessive slack.
  • Accounting for the radius of bends, ensuring they are gradual rather than tight.
  • Verifying that the flex duct diameter matches the collar of the supply or return register.

The Critical Rule of Length

One of the most common mistakes in flex duct installation is exceeding the maximum recommended length. Industry standards generally dictate that the total equivalent length of a flex duct run, including any elbows, should not exceed a specific limit relative to its diameter. Exceeding this limit creates excessive static pressure, which reduces the efficiency of the entire system and can lead to uneven heating or cooling.

Securing the Ductwork Properly

Once the path is planned, the physical attachment of the flex duct is the next crucial step. The duct must be supported at regular intervals to prevent it from sagging under its own weight or moving due to HVAC system vibration. Sagging creates creases that restrict airflow and reduce efficiency.

Support is typically provided using metal hanger straps or wire ties. These fasteners should be placed approximately 4 to 5 feet apart and positioned to prevent the duct from twisting. It is vital to attach the straps to the solid framing of the building rather than just nailing into the drywall, ensuring the duct remains stable for the lifespan of the system.

Insulation and Vapor Barriers

If the flex duct runs through unconditioned spaces such as attics or crawlspaces, proper insulation is non-negotiable. The R-value of the insulation must match the climate zone of the building to prevent energy loss and condensation issues. Furthermore, the vapor barrier on the insulation must be sealed carefully at the seams and around the hangers to prevent moisture from penetrating the duct material.

Attaching to Registers and Handling Air Connections

The final meters of the flex duct connection to the register or air handler require meticulous attention to detail. The connection should be tight and sealed using UL-listed foil tape or a compatible mastic sealant. Simply using a metal ring without proper sealing allows air to leak into the attic or walls, negating the energy efficiency of the system.

When connecting to an air handler or plenum, it is best practice to use a boot or a durable metal collar rather than relying solely on the flex duct crush. This ensures a stable, airtight connection that does not put stress on the wiring of the flex duct, which could lead to tears over time.

Common Pitfalls to Avoid

Even experienced installers can fall into traps that compromise system performance. One frequent error is using flex duct as a permanent replacement for rigid trunk line ducting. While acceptable for short connection runs, relying solely on flex duct for the main distribution lines creates excessive friction and noise.

Another pitfall involves the use of incorrect hose clamps. Standard worm-drive clamps can dig into the thin wall of the flex duct, creating a point of restriction. It is recommended to use flat-style hose clamps that distribute pressure evenly around the circumference, maintaining the internal diameter of the duct.

Ultimately, flex duct installation is a blend of science and craft. Adhering to strict length limitations, ensuring proper suspension, and prioritizing airtight seals are the cornerstones of an installation that delivers quiet, efficient, and reliable performance for years to come.
